2# Phy drivers for Mediatek devices
3#
4config PHY_MTK_TPHY
5    tristate "MediaTek T-PHY Driver"
6    depends on ARCH_MEDIATEK && OF
7    select GENERIC_PHY
8    help
9      Say 'Y' here to add support for MediaTek T-PHY driver,
10      it supports multiple usb2.0, usb3.0 ports, PCIe and
11	  SATA, and meanwhile supports two version T-PHY which have
12	  different banks layout, the T-PHY with shared banks between
13	  multi-ports is first version, otherwise is second veriosn,
14	  so you can easily distinguish them by banks layout.
15
16config PHY_MTK_UFS
17	tristate "MediaTek UFS M-PHY driver"
18	depends on ARCH_MEDIATEK && OF
19	select GENERIC_PHY
20	help
21	  Support for UFS M-PHY on MediaTek chipsets.
22	  Enable this to provide vendor-specific probing,
23	  initialization, power on and power off flow of
24	  specified M-PHYs.
25
26config PHY_MTK_XSPHY
27    tristate "MediaTek XS-PHY Driver"
28    depends on ARCH_MEDIATEK && OF
29    select GENERIC_PHY
30    help
31	  Enable this to support the SuperSpeedPlus XS-PHY transceiver for
32	  USB3.1 GEN2 controllers on MediaTek chips. The driver supports
33	  multiple USB2.0, USB3.1 GEN2 ports.
